Which linear equation has no solution?
3/2 (9x +6) 3
5x + 12 = 5x -7
4x + 7 = 3x + 7
-3(2x - 5) = 15 - 6x

Answer:

  5x + 12 = 5x - 7

Step-by-step explanation:

There will be no solution when the coefficients of x are the same on both sides of the equal sign and the constants are different. That is the case for ...

  5x + 12 = 5x - 7

This reduces to ...

  19 = 0 . . . . . no value of x will make this be true: NO SOLUTION
